Continue ReadingI’ve traveled to three individual games so far this season, checking out Dublin Coffman @ Westerville South, Pickerington North @ Pickerington Central and Hilliard Davidson @ Linden-McKinley. In this article I’ll be breaking down the top performers from these games.
Jadi Cunningham Jr Jadi Cunningham Jr 6'1" | PG Westerville South | 2023 State OH , 5’10 PG Westerville South 2023: Cunningham was very impressive in Westerville South’s victory over Dublin Coffman. Westerville South runs a very big starting lineup as Cunningham is the primary ball-handler and the only non-senior in the starting lineup. Cunningham plays with good pace and picked his spots to attack well. Cunningham was a player I was unaware about prior to this game but certainly made his case to be added to the rankings after the next update.
Aiden Schmidt Aiden Schmidt 6'3" | SF Dublin Coffman | 2023 State OH , 6’3 SF Dublin Coffman 2023: Schmidt got HOT in the third quarter against Westerville South, hitting some 3-pointers from the parking lot. After graduating one of the best shooters in the state in Nash Hostetler, Schmidt is next in line as a sniper for the Shamrocks. I’d expect Schmidt to get a lot of small college interest during this summer.
Devin Royal Devin Royal 6'6" | PF Pickerington Central | 2023 State #49 Nation OH , 6’6 PF Pickerington Central 2023: Royal has completely transformed his body and became a totally different level of athlete from where he was last Winter. It’s night and day in terms of explosiveness for Royal, as he’s getting multiple dunks almost every game. Tip slams, alley-oops, you name it, and Royal is throwing it down. Royal is a no brainer high major target and has received a ton of interest from some of the best schools in the Midwest.
Lance Pressley Lance Pressley 6'5" | PF Pickerington Central | 2022 State OH , 6’6 PF Pickerington Central 2022: Pressley shot the ball well and gave Pickerington Central some much needed offense in the first half when Royal was on the bench with foul trouble. Pressley was left open by Pickerington North and made the Panthers pay each time he caught the ball with time and space to fire away. Pressley is an intriguing small college prospect with his run and jump ability, plus his shooting that he displayed in a big rivalry game. He doesn’t have the most in game experience as he’s been a bench piece for Pickerington Central, but I think he could really put things together and be a major contributor as an upperclassman under the right developmental program.
LA Walker LA Walker 6'5" | SF Linden-McKinley | 2022 State OH , 6’5 SF Linden-McKinley 2022: Walker was a problem for Hilliard Davidson and despite the loss, was the most dominant player on the floor. Walker has nice size at the wing position and simply shot over defenders for a lot of 3-pointers all game. Walker ended with 34 points and simply couldn’t be stopped by any Davidson defender. Walker should be a target for JUCO’s looking for some shooting from the wing position.
